Olive oil can be used as one of the home remedies for cat hairballs.

Olive oil for cats hairballs. Promotes healthy skin and fur. The type of fats used should be unsaturated because saturated fats can be harmful to cats. Presence of oil in a cat’s digestive system aids digestion by eliminating hair in the cat’s stool.

It even helps in digesting the food. To help get rid of cat hairballs, make sure to groom your cat regularly, look for remedies for hairball control, add canned pumpkin or olive oil to their food, and make sure they are drinking enough water. If you add a single teaspoon of olive oil in your kitty’s food once or twice on a weekly basis it would prevent the kitty from vomiting hairballs.

Mineral oil had previously been recommended for hairballs, but it carries the risk of aspiration (going down into the lungs) since it doesn’t trigger a cough reflex. Other oils, such as mineral oil, corn oil or saffron oil can also help. The oil lubricates the digestive system of the cat which enables hairballs to slide right through without causing any disturbance to her tummy.

Studies have shown that having your cat consume foods that contain oil (or consuming oil by itself) can help cure its bout with hairballs. Olive oil is a lubricant that also acts as a laxative and is simpler to digest than petroleum. Regular intake can create a surplus of calories in their everyday diet, leading to weight gain.
